Is it truly failure to thrive, dropping like a stone off the growth chart?
or it is a small person growing at own pace consistently on one of the
lower percentiles?  Compare the baby to  himself, not every other baby.  Is
it failure to eat "real" food that bothers the HCPs?  Baby knows best!  I
find these kids are usually allergic and have the good sense not to eat
unitl they are ready.  In cases like this I'm truly glad if mom is BFing
and baby is getting the best, until  he decides to eat the rest!  Also how
is he developmentally?  Doing most of the normal things you would expect a
17 mo old to  do?  Is he nibbling on things in the home, without actually
sitting down and "eating a meal?  There are so many issues here.  I
absolutely disagree with forcibly weaning this child.  What if he CAN'T eat
anything else? Hyperal? Oh yeah, that's a great solution.   Sincerely, Pat
